The Meaning Of The Word Basket Case. If you describe someone as a basket case, you think that they are very nervous or unable to function. A person who is helpless or incapable of functioning normally, especially due to overwhelming stress, anxiety, or the like. What's the meaning of the phrase 'basket case'? Usa, 1918—originally a soldier who had lost all four limbs during the first world war and had to be transported in a basket A person who is emotionally or mentally unable to cope, esp. Originally this referred to soldiers who had lost arms and legs and had to be. The meaning of basket case is a person who is functionally incapacitated from extreme nervousness, emotional distress, mental or. Used especially in newspapers to describe a country, company, or organization that has very serious financial problems: If someone describes a country or organization as a basket case, they mean that its economy or finances are in a seriously bad state.
